This week's BAA Wednesday Webinar at 7pm (British Summer Time) is on spectroscopy and is being given by Hugh Allen. During the Q&A session at the end, Hugh will be joined Robin Leadbeater, David Boyd and myself. The title of the webinar is "From Kitchens to Comets - Hunting for molecules with a spectroscope". It is free for anyone to join either via the Zoom webinar link or the BAA YouTube channel.
